| Re: M60 Patton Yes, the ERA panels are removable. BUT, it still leaves the mounting brackets on the diecast when they are removed. So, it looks kinda funny. If you are trying to go from a ODS M-60 to a Cold War M-60 without ERA, then you are going to be out of luck. Unless you take a dremel and start sawing away. | |||||||||||||
